    Souvenir 2013 Optical Fiber Project & its Impact Background In the initial days‚ the backhaul of telecom equipments relied on microwave and satellite communication. The rapid proliferation of various telecom technologies and the desire to penetrate larger market segments resulted in high national and international traffic.     Advantages and Disadvantages of Fiber Optics An optical fiber is a thin and flexible fiber that carries the light between the two ends of the fiber. Optical fibers are widely used in Fiber Optic Communications‚ which is the transmission over longer distances at higher bandwidths than other communications.
